5 Tips For Successfully Selling Your Company

Selling a company can be a challenging and complex process Whether you are looking to retire, move on to a new venture, or simply want to cash out on your hard work, there are many factors to consider when selling your business In order to ensure a successful and profitable sale, it is important to carefully plan and strategize every step of the way

To help you navigate the process of selling your company, here are 5 tips to keep in mind:

1 Prepare Your Company for Sale
Before putting your company on the market, it is crucial to ensure that it is in the best possible shape This includes making sure your financial records are up-to-date and well-organized, preparing a detailed business plan, and addressing any potential issues or areas for improvement Buyers will be looking for a well-run and profitable business, so it is important to showcase the strengths and potential of your company.

2 Find the Right Buyer
When selling your company, it is important to find a buyer who not only has the financial means to purchase your business, but also shares your vision and values Take the time to research potential buyers and find one who is a good fit for your company culture and goals Building a relationship with the buyer can also help ensure a smoother and more successful sale process.

3 Seek Professional Help
Selling a company involves a lot of legal and financial complexities, so it is important to seek professional help from experts such as business brokers, lawyers, and accountants These professionals can help you navigate the process, negotiate the best deal, and ensure that all legal requirements are met Having a team of experts on your side can make the selling process much smoother and less stressful.

When selling your company, it is important to negotiate a fair price that reflects the value of your business Consider factors such as your company’s assets, cash flow, customer base, and growth potential when determining the asking price Be prepared to negotiate with potential buyers and be willing to be flexible in order to reach a mutually beneficial agreement.

5 Plan for the Future
Once you have successfully sold your company, it is important to have a plan for the future Whether you are retiring, starting a new venture, or simply taking a break, it is important to have a clear vision of what you will do next Consider your financial goals, personal interests, and long-term plans when deciding on your next steps Selling your company can be a major life transition, so it is important to plan ahead and ensure a smooth transition.
